Message type: E = Error
Message class: IWB_MPS - Messages for Multi-Product Support
Message number: 154
Message text: Synchronization started in the background

- Synchronization started in the background ?The SAP error message IWB_MPS154, which states "Synchronization started in the background," typically occurs in the context of SAP's Integrated Business Planning (IBP) or other applications that involve data synchronization processes. This message indicates that a synchronization process has been initiated but is still running in the background, which may lead to issues if users are trying to access data that is being synchronized.
Cause:
- Ongoing Synchronization: The primary cause of this message is that a synchronization process is already in progress. This can happen if a previous synchronization was not completed or if multiple synchronization requests were initiated simultaneously.
- Long-running Processes: If the synchronization process takes longer than expected due to large data volumes or system performance issues, users may encounter this message.
- System Configuration: Incorrect configuration settings in the IBP or related systems can lead to synchronization issues.
Solution:
- Check Background Jobs: Use transaction codes like
SM37
to check the status of background jobs. Look for any jobs related to synchronization that are currently running. If a job is stuck, you may need to terminate it.- Wait for Completion: If the synchronization is still running, it may be best to wait for it to complete before attempting to initiate another synchronization.
- Review Logs: Check the logs for any errors or warnings that may indicate why the synchronization is taking longer than expected. This can provide insights into any underlying issues.
- System Performance: Ensure that the system has adequate resources (CPU, memory, etc.) to handle the synchronization process efficiently.
- Configuration Review: Review the configuration settings related to synchronization in IBP or the relevant application to ensure they are set up correctly.
- Contact Support: If the issue persists and you cannot identify the cause,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ance.
